The Flower
Symphony
grows wild in
spring,
crescendos in
summer,
encores in autumn
'til the white
curtain falls.
Poet’s Notes: This
poem attempts a playful blending of musical performance terms with the wild
flowers of spring, the profusion of color in summer, a resurgence of color with
fall's own late bloomers, and the hush when snow comes.
